Side effects and dangers of fetal heart rate monitors

There is no evidence of side effects or harm from fetal heartbeat devices. Under normal circumstances, fetal heart rate monitors do not affect the fetus or the mother. Fetal heart rate monitor mainly detects the fetal heart rate and fetal movement, and can be used by mothers without any worry. Fetal heart rate monitor is based on the Doppler principle to check whether the fetal heart rate and fetal movement are abnormal. Doctors can determine the health status of the fetus in the womb according to the fetal heart rate monitor, and make timely and appropriate treatment if there is any abnormality. Fetal heart monitor can be used from 16 weeks of pregnancy to monitor the fetal heartbeat. Generally speaking, the normal use of fetal heart rate monitor is not affected, fetal heart rate monitor acoustic radiation dose is far below the safety index requirements, but the use of fetal heart rate monitor in small gestational weeks to listen to the fetal heart needs certain skills, pregnant women use at home by themselves, such as diagnosis of the fetal heart, remember not to be too alarmed.
